site stats

Npath nesting complexity

Webint npath = complexityMultipleOf ( node, 1, data ); DataPoint point = new DataPoint (); point. setNode ( node ); point. setScore ( 1.0 * npath ); point. setMessage ( getMessage ()); addDataPoint ( point ); if ( LOGGER. isLoggable ( Level. FINEST )) { LOGGER. finest ( "NPath complexity: " + npath + " for line " + node. getBeginLine () + ", column " Web1 mrt. 1992 · NPath is intended to correlate well with the number of acyclic paths through the code under consideration. Such a number does seem to correspond with our intuitive notion of complexity and in fact we will show that NPath bears up very well under Weyuker's criteria. In addition it is easily computed automatically.

CyclomaticComplexityCheck (checkstyle 10.9.3 API) - SourceForge

Web* The NPATH metric was designed base on Cyclomatic complexity to avoid problem * of Cyclomatic complexity metric like nesting level within a function (method). * * WebSo the NPath complexity is exponential and could easily get out of hand, in old legacy code don’t be surprised if you find functions with complexity over 100 000. The default value … outbag https://profiretx.com

ACM Digital Library

http://api.dpml.net/checkstyle/3.5/com/puppycrawl/tools/checkstyle/checks/metrics/NPathComplexityCheck.html WebCyclomatic complexity is a software metric used to indicate the complexity of a program.It is a quantitative measure of the number of linearly independent paths through a … WebAverage nesting NPath complexity . Data flow Graph theoretical approach requires completed code . SOFTWARE ENGINEERING INSTITUTE CARNEGIE MELLON … outbags discount code

PMD - NPath complexity very high with ternary operator

Category:PMD - NPath complexity very high with ternary operator

Tags:Npath nesting complexity

Npath nesting complexity

NPath値とは何でしょうか

WebAlthough strategies to reduce the NPATH complexity of functions are important, care must be taken not to distort the logical clarity of the software by applying a strategy to reduce the complexity of functions. WebFor every other edge, assign it weight − 2. Now the previous graph has an Hamiltonian path if and only if there is a simple path with negative total weight from s to t in the new graph. …

Npath nesting complexity

Did you know?

http://eli.johogo.com/pdf/NCC-1987.pdf Web13 jul. 2024 · NPATH: a measure of execution path complexity and its applications, Brian A. Nejmeh, Communications of the ACM, volume 31, issue 2, février 1988. Là où …

WebLOC Lines of Code. Nesting counts the maximum nesting within a function. McCabe Complexity aka cyclomatic complexity counts the number of nodes in the control flow … Web所以我的建议是:. 将您的功能拆分为较小的功能. 尽可能消除无用的if / else语句. 相关讨论. 方法的NPath复杂度是通过该方法的非循环执行路径的数量,或者简单的解释是函数中 …

WebSee the GNU 013 // Lesser General Public License for more details. 014 // 015 // You should have received a copy of the GNU Lesser General Public 016 // License along with this library; if not, write to the Free Software 017 //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A 018 ///// 019 020 package com.puppycrawl.tools ... WebChecks the NPATH complexity against a specified limit. The NPATH metric computes the number of possible execution paths through a function(method). It takes into account the …

Web4 mrt. 2010 · · NPathComplexity: The NPath complexity of a method is the number of acyclic execution paths through that method. A threshold of 200 is generally considered …

WebClass CyclomaticComplexityCheck. Checks cyclomatic complexity against a specified limit. It is a measure of the minimum number of possible paths through the source and therefore the number of required tests, it is not about quality of code! It is only applied to methods, c-tors, static initializers and instance initializers . rolf byeWeb19 feb. 2024 · Complexity is determined by the number of decision points in a method plus one for the method entry. The decision points are ‘if’, ‘while’, ‘for’, and ‘case labels’. … rolf campehttp://docs.oclint.org/en/stable/rules/size.html rolf campoWeb8 okt. 2010 · En résumé, la complexité cyclomatique compte le nombre de chemins sur la route, la complexité NPath le nombre total de possibilités pour arriver du début à la fin de la route en empruntant ces chemins. Contexte : je procédais justement à une amélioration de l'article Wikipédia ci-dessus, et recherchais s'il existait en français une ... outbag outdoor-sitzsack peak plusWebSee the GNU 13 // Lesser General Public License for more details. 14 // 15 // You should have received a copy of the GNU Lesser General Public 16 // License along with this … rolf bytschewskyWeb19 okt. 2024 · Boston-based software company Axelerant recommends a couple of steps to reduce cyclomatic and the NPath complexity: (1) “Use small methods.”. (2) “Reduce … outbags holsters siteoutback 意味